    F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ONS How long will it take to assemble the building? Assembly time depends on a variety of factors, including roof design, tools available, DIY skill and the pace at which you work. Guidelines for each shed assembly are approximate AFTER completion of the base, and assume two or more people working on the assembly.
  • Page 6 What kind of base do I use? You can: •Use an Arrow Base Kit •Pour a concrete slab •Build a wood deck/fl oor (use exterior-grade plywood) •Use patio blocks •Build on crushed gravel, dirt or grass Arrow provides a base kit accessory that is an option for most building sizes.   • Page 8 CARE & MAINTENANCE... Exterior Care: For a long lasting fi nish, clean and wax the exterior surface. We recommend washing with a mild soap solution. DO NOT use power washing to clean your shed. Using a spray automotive type wax periodically on the exterior is highly recommended if you are in a high humidity or coastal climate region.
